Website testing 101
Website testing entails the evaluation of a website's functionality, overall performance, user-friendliness, usability, and other important features. This operation is a vital step in the development process that helps web developers at a digital agency identify and fix any bugs or issues that may hinder the way website visitors experience the whole thing.
Types of website testing
- Functional testing. This is needed to make sure that all of the features of the website are live and working correctly. This includes evaluating the site's menus, forms, and other interactive elements.
- Usability evaluation. This step is about testing the website's usability, taking into account its layout, UI/UX design, style, and so on. This one is also immensely important when you decide to change the design of the website.
- Performance analysis. Here you measure a website's responsiveness, speed, and capacity for traffic. Testing the website's loading speed, server response time, and general performance while under various loads is important for having a clear picture of your website’s health.
- Security testing. Testing of this type is done for assessing a website's security capabilities, such as its capacity to fend against hacking attempts, data leaks, and other security risks.
- Compatibility testing. It’s needed to ensure that the website functions properly across a range of browsers, devices, and operating systems.
Website testing can be done manually or automatically with the help of different tools. While automated testing employs various technologies to replicate user interactions and verify the website's performance, manual testing entails manually examining the features and functionality of the website.
Website testing should always be an ongoing project to make sure the website is usable and functional at all times. Before launching a new website or making significant changes to an existing one, testing is a crucial first step.
Conclusion
It's important to test a website as part of the development process to make sure it's secure, usable, and functional. To keep the website performant, you should conduct testing on a regular basis. If you would like to learn more about this side of web development, contact us!
Subscribe to receive the latest blog posts to your inbox every week.